Форматирование данных из БД

Ответить

Код подтверждения
Введите код в точности так, как вы его видите. Регистр символов не имеет значения.

BBCode ВКЛЮЧЁН
[img] ВКЛЮЧЁН
[url] ВКЛЮЧЁН
Смайлики ОТКЛЮЧЕНЫ

Обзор темы
   

Развернуть Обзор темы: Форматирование данных из БД

Naeel Maqsudov » 06 апр 2004, 15:11

У полей (TStringField) есть свойства, задающие маску вывода и маску редактирования

Кажется они называются .DisplayFormat и .EditMask

Автоматическая расстановка литералов в определенных позициях - это меньшее, на что способны маски.

delphi-coder

delphi-coder » 05 апр 2004, 13:28

А так:

Код: Выделить всё

var
  tmp: string;

str := datamodule2.ADOTablPartner.Fields[4].AsString;
datamodule2.ADOTablPartner.Fields[4].Value := 
'( '+ copy(tmp, 1, 6) + ')' + copy(tmp, 7, 4) + '-' + copy(str, 11, 3) ;

Вернуться к началу